North Carolina regulation says all drivers must have uninsured driver coverage. This protection helps with injury claims yet not for home damage in hit-and-run instances. But, uninsured motorist building damage insurance coverage can assist pay for automobile repair services if the at-fault chauffeur is located but has no insurance policy. When the at-fault driver does not have insurance coverage, the victim might need to go after settlement with a civil suit. A lawyer streamlines this procedure, taking care of the paperwork, communication, and negotiation in your place.
